Colloquium
Symmetry and the Origin of Mass
Christopher T. Hill

The main goal of experimentally based particle physics in the present era is to understand the mechanism that generates the electron mass, which will also answer to the question: why are the weak forces weak? We show how this question intertwines with symmetry, and how mass is always associated with symmetry breaking.
